Cadw's description
Location
One of the associated structures in the gardens of St Fagans Castle and part of the Museum of Welsh Life.
History
C18 or earlier. A formal enclosure as an entrance to a country house is characteristic of the early C17 and part of the walling may date from that period.
Exterior
Garden wall of limestone rubble about 2.5m in height. There is a doorway in the wall with a slightly cambered headed arch of dressed stone, a parapet with ramped coping and very ornate wrought iron gate. There is a further doorway towards the east end of the wall; this opens on to the rose garden and has a pointed head with stone voussoirs and stone parapet and a boarded door with hinges.
Reason for designation
Included as one of the structures associated with the gardens and estate of St. Fagans Castle.
